Output 1b312073361359c071253017d6d5eb4956fbbbcd6e44e67d61cf2c6355a1b690:2

value
72586879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684b5699f6c983bf3dcac1d712460ff593e41bb6 OP_EQUAL
address
3BCUT6BC8MZL7AAHW6BbvatM7HNAoQSKYp
transaction
1b312073361359c071253017d6d5eb4956fbbbcd6e44e67d61cf2c6355a1b690
spent
true